Congee is a grain based, medicinal porridge served for centuries in traditional East Indian and Chinese homes. It is as common in some homes as pizza & mac and cheese are here! This is an easy and affordable dish to incorporate into any diet. It is used preventatively to promote good health and strong digestion….
